A case of fetal loss due to infection after first‐trimester chorionic villus sampling is described. The fetus was born at 18 3/7 weeks and showed an annular constriction of one of the arms as seen in the amniotic band sequence. Induction of congenital defects might be one of the complications of chorionic villus sampling.
